Depositors with commercial banks in Guinea-Bissau
Guinea-Bissau: Depositors with commercial banks was 129.92 per 1,000 adults in 2024. ◆ Volatile
Depositors with commercial banks in Guinea-Bissau, 2004–2024
Source: Financial Access Survey, International Monetary Fund (IMF). Measured in per 1,000 adults.
Analysis
In 2024, depositors with commercial banks in Guinea-Bissau stood at 129.92 per 1,000 adults.
That represents a change of down 2.6% on the previous year and up 70.1% over ten years.
Over the whole period, depositors with commercial banks in Guinea-Bissau peaked at 163.31 per 1,000 adults in 2021 and was at its lowest, 9.2 per 1,000 adults, in 2004.
Guinea-Bissau ranks 95th of 104 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

About this data
Depositors with commercial banks are the reported number of deposit account holders, including both resident non-financial corporations (both public and private) and individuals from the household sector, at commercial banks within the reporting jurisdiction for every 1,000 adults. The major types of deposits are checking accounts, savings accounts, and time deposits.
